WebIf you’re wondering how to spell principal of a school, just remember that this person can be your pal, which are the last three letters of this word: p-r-i-n-c-i-p-a-l. As a noun, principal refers to someone who oversees a school (in American English) or a college or university (in British and Canadian English). WebReceive or Recieve — Which Is the Correct Spelling? “Receive” is the correct spelling of the word, not “recieve.”. The word “recieve” is a common mistake that is not a real word in English. People often confuse the position of “i,” and “e” in this word as most of the words follow the pattern “ie” in English. The … small pouch on a top crosswordWebIn spelling the word ‘necessary’, it can be difficult to remember how many c’s and s’s to put- and where. To remember that the single c comes first, think that the collar is on the top of your body and the two socks are at the bottom! Goofy Greg loved to exaggerate.
